In our area, there are many homes that were built with crawl space areas in addition to basements. For many years, these were created with vents which was intended to increase air flow into the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, the opposite is usually what happens. The vents allow water to get in during rain and snow storms and the vents prevent proper evaporation which causes the humidity levels to stay high which can harbor the growth of mildew. We have found that up to ½ of the air in your home has come up through the crawl space so having the space closed off from the elements and controlling excess humidity will increase the overall air quality in your home.

We have been dealing with crawl spaces as long as we have been in business and we know the best way to seal them off and control high humidity. This is done using a process known as encapsulation which is the installation of a thick liner or vapor barrier, occasionally installed with insulation products, and are sturdy plastic and vinyl sheets as well as vent covers and a heavy duty door that will seal the area totally and prevent any excess moisture from entering. This will also prevent pests and animals from getting in your crawl space which will keep any equipment there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After your crawl space is closed off, if you need it we will install a series of sagging floor jacks to stabilize sloping floors in your home.

The foundation of your home is easily one of, if not the, most important areas of the home. It not only supports the building itself but it also is the basement walls. If you have any foundation problems, normally they will show themselves in the form of diagonal cracks in your brickwork, cracks that run along the foundation or across basement walls. Sometimes, you will see that your windows will get stuck or there may be cracks at the corners of them. You may not think these problems seem critical at first, they are all indicators of a sinking or settling foundation and they should be evaluated by an expert for particular problems to determine if a repair needs to be performed.

It is good that the most common foundation problems are caused by similar things and our experts are very good at spotting these issues. We can implement a repair solution that is for your specific problem to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ation or walls. If the problem is a settling foundation, we will implement a series of foundation piers to level the foundation. We will install either push piers or helical piers, depending on where and how bad the sinking is. Both types of piers are very strong and are able to stabilize your foundation.
